Harmony is a modern music app that uses AI to help users create personalized playlists. The app’s design takes inspiration from industry-leading platforms like Apple Music and Spotify, combining their sleek, user-friendly interfaces with AI-driven features to enhance the music discovery experience.

Research
User Research
To understand the needs and preferences of music app users, I conducted user interviews and surveys. Key findings:
Music Discovery: Users feel overwhelmed by too many choices and prefer personalized recommendations based on their preferences and activities.
Ease of Use: Users appreciate simple, intuitive interfaces and quick access to new music and playlists.
Mood-based Playlists: Many users expressed interest in features that tailor music to their current mood or activity.
Competitive Analysis
I analyzed platforms like Apple Music and Spotify, focusing on:
Spotify: Known for its playlist curation and personalized recommendations (e.g., Daily Mix, Discover Weekly).
Apple Music: Features a sleek, premium design and curated playlists based on user activity and preferences.
Both apps use algorithms to offer personalized recommendations, but none fully integrate mood-based playlist creation, which I saw as a unique opportunity for Harmony.

Design Process
1. Wireframing
I began by sketching low-fidelity wireframes to establish the structure of the app, focusing on core features like playlist creation, mood input, and user profiles. The layout was designed to be simple and uncluttered, ensuring that users can easily navigate through different sections of the app.
2. UI Design
The UI design was inspired by Apple Music's sleek and minimalist aesthetic and Spotify's vibrant, dynamic elements.
Color Scheme: I used a combination of deep blues and purples with contrasting white text for a modern, calming effect.
Typography: The app features large, bold typography for headers and clean, readable fonts for smaller text.
Iconography: Simple, intuitive icons for easy navigation, mimicking the familiar style of music apps.
Main Screens:
Home Screen: Displays AI-generated playlist recommendations, personalized based on the user’s preferences and listening history.
Mood Input Screen: Allows users to select their current mood and receive playlist suggestions tailored to that mood.
Playlist Screen: Shows the curated playlist with options to shuffle, skip, or save to favorites.
Profile Screen: Displays the user’s listening history, preferred genres, and allows for further customization of the AI recommendations.
